Различные вопросы по PHP и MySQL

242K
.
Подскажите как правильно подсчитать количество заполненных строк в определенном столбце?
.
The Fast, Secure and Professional - Yii2
# Str@nnik (15.02.2015 / 16:23)
Подскажите как правильно подсчитать количество заполненных строк в определенном столбце?
Может столбцов в таблице?
.
Rakovskiy, Нет. Именно заполненных строк в определенном столбце
.
Rakovskiy
The Fast, Secure and Professional - Yii2
# Str@nnik (15.02.2015 / 17:20)
Rakovskiy, Нет. Именно заполненных строк в определенном столбце
Мне не понятно, что подразумевается под "заполненных строк". Общее количество строк в столбце? То есть типа

Текст
Текст
Текст
Текст
Текст

И нужно посчитать сколько строк?
.
Rakovskiy, Посчитай сколько в столбце plus заполненных строк
.
......
Прикрепленные файлы:
.
The Fast, Secure and Professional - Yii2
$total = mysql_result(mysql_query("SELECT COUNT(id) FROM `table` WHERE `plus` IS NOT NULL"), 0);


table не забудь поменять
.
Rakovskiy, Спасибо. Просто и понятно. А то я там такого наизобретал...
.
# Rakovskiy (15.02.2015 / 18:07)
$total = mysql_result(mysql_query("SELECT COUNT(id) FROM `table` WHERE `plus` IS NOT NULL"), 0);


table не забудь поменять
COUNT(*) работает быстрее
.
The Fast, Secure and Professional - Yii2
# ramzes (15.02.2015 / 23:58)
COUNT(*) работает быстрее
Не буду отрицать, но когда учил MySQL запросы, чёт читал про оптимизацию то если память не изменяет писали везде, что COUNT(id) быстрей. Но честно я отношусь к такой оптимизации несерьёзно, какая-то доля мс ничего не даст
Всего: 7969